Toshiba Memory Corporation (東芝メモリ株式会社, Tōshiba Memori Kabushiki-gaisha) is a Japanese multinational computer memory manufacturer headquartered in Tokyo, Japan. The company was spun off from the Toshiba Corporation conglomerate in 2018.[1]

In the third quarter of 2018, the company was estimated to have 19% of the global revenue share for NAND solid-state drives.[2]

On July 18 2019 Toshiba Memory Holdings Corporation announced it will change its name to Kioxia Holdings Corporation on October 1 2019, including all Toshiba Memory companies. Kioxia is a combination of the Japanese word kioku meaning memory and the Greek word axia meaning value.[3]
